Wall Mounted Electric Fireplaces
A wall mounted electric fireplace can be a stunning addition to any room. They can be mounted on the wall or built into the wall for an ideal design.
The majority of wall-mounted electric fire places include an electric heater that adds warmth to the room. You can operate them using an remote control or control panel.
Size
In general, wall mounted electric fire places come in a variety sizes to accommodate different rooms. However, what is the ideal size of an electric fireplace for your home depends on a variety of factors including the size of the room and the wall's depth where it will be placed.
In general, lighter electric fires work best in smaller spaces whereas deep models are ideal for larger spaces. However, the most important aspect is to determine the amount of heat needed in the area where the fireplace is installed. The majority of fireplaces have a range of heat settings to help you choose the right amount of warmth for your room.
The majority of wall-mounted electric fire places are designed to either be flush or integrated into the wall. It is recommended to hire an expert for the latter since it requires cutting a section of the wall in order to accommodate the unit. For instance, a flush-mounted model can be mounted on the wall like any other piece of furniture.
There are a variety of electric fire places that are freestanding for those who prefer a traditional appearance. Many feature a mantle and frame that gives them the appearance like a real fire. Some have a long design that fits under a television.
While freestanding electric fireplaces offer an elegant appearance, they don't produce as much heat as other alternatives. There are wall-mounted electric fireplace places that can provide a decent amount of supplemental heat for medium-sized spaces up to 300 ft2.
The Allusion is a very popular option and is available in various frame finishes. It can be partially recessed or completely recessed into a 2x6 frame wall. It appears as polished on the wall as any other piece of furniture. It is also possible to construct an enclosure for this kind of fireplace, but it's not usually necessary. Another option is the distinctive Scion Trinity, one of the newest electric fireplaces on the market. The multi-sided design eliminates an enclosure and makes it one of the simplest electric fireplaces to set up. It also provides more flexibility when it comes to finishing materials than models that are fully or partially recessed and have to be connected to the studs.

Heat
Unlike traditional fireplaces that use coal and logs flat wall fireplace mounted electric fireplaces include a heating element at the bottom to blow warm air into the room. They are perfect for people who wish to have a fireplace in their home, but don't have a traditional fireplace due to space restrictions or a lack of space.
The majority of models have an electric fan that can supply up to 5,000 BTUs in rooms up to 400 square foot in size. The flame color and brightness can be adjusted to fit your preferences. Some models also have an alarm clock that can be set ahead of time to make it easier.
When choosing a wall-mounted electric fireplace, it is important to consider whether the fireplace will be freestanding or recessing into the wall. Freestanding models let you pick the place of mounting. Recessed models, however, need to be installed by professionals. No matter what method you choose to install there are a few easy steps you can follow to ensure a fast and easy setup.
Before beginning the installation process, make sure your fireplace is operating properly. Plug it in and test the flames and heat to make sure everything functions properly. After that choose a suitable location for it to be on the walls and begin the installation process. First, mount the bracket on the bottom of the wall by placing it over hooks or slots on the back of the fireplace. Then, place the slots on the back of the fireplace over the hooks on the wall bracket and insert the hooks into the slots to secure the fireplace to the wall.
While installing your new electric fireplace for your wall, remember that you must keep all combustible objects at least three feet away from the fireplace. This will reduce the risk of a fire, by making fire-resistant materials more difficult to ignite if they're too close. Additionally, you should not restrict the vents of your fireplace. They are designed to provide an ongoing exchange of fresh and hot air, which makes it run more efficiently and avoid overheating.
Safety
Many wall-mounted electric fireplaces have a screen that maintains a low temperature during the use of the fireplace and protects against burns. They also operate and wall mounted electric fireplaces keep heat at a lower temperature than traditional fireplaces, making them suitable for homes with children and pets. Certain models come with features, for instance the fire-only mode, which allows you enjoy the appearance of a fire, but without the heat.
Generally speaking, electric fireplaces are designed to be used as supplemental heating sources rather than primary ones. You should always follow the guidelines and safety guidelines that come with the specific model you have purchased to ensure proper operation and safety. Be sure that the space surrounding your fireplace is free of combustible materials and isn't obstructed by furniture or drapes. It's important to keep any flammable items at least three feet from the fireplace in order to reduce the risk of fire and allow for the circulation of hot air. It is also important to check the vents regularly to ensure that they are free of blockage and that there is enough fresh air available to efficiently operate your fireplace.
Apart from following the manufacturer's guidelines and the general safety guidelines that are listed above, you should be aware of any strange sound or smells that might occur while your fireplace is being used. These could indicate electrical or mechanical issues that could create serious safety risks and must be addressed immediately by a qualified professional.
Electric fireplaces aren't often involved in accidents, but they should be considered dangerous devices that require the proper installation and use. An electrician who is certified should carry out the installation and be aware of local codes and regulations pertaining to the use of electric fireplaces. They should be able to provide you information regarding the warranty, maintenance, and replacement of parts.
